Jelani Woods is a 6'7 former QB who received all-american honors his first season as a tight end. An intriguing developmental prospect out of Virginia.
6'7", 253 lbs, 34 1/2" arms, 9 1/2" handsRan a 4.6 forty at the combine.

Overall, Woods has the upside of being a first- and second-down Y tight end who becomes a safety valve for quarterbacks on underneath and intermediate routes. He also has the ability to be a valid weapon when teams enter the red zone.
